What are the primary functions of industrial-grade constant temperature furnaces for NiCoCrAlY oxidation kinetics?


Industrial-grade constant temperature furnaces serve as the critical validation environment for determining the longevity of NiCoCrAlY coatings. Their primary function is to conduct long-term static isothermal oxidation tests, which simulate the thermal stresses of real-world working conditions—typically at temperatures between 800°C and 900°C.

The core purpose of this equipment is to provide a stable thermal field necessary to verify whether a pre-oxidized α-Al2O3 layer effectively inhibits oxygen diffusion and slows the growth rate of Thermally Grown Oxides (TGO).

Simulating Real-World Service Conditions

To understand the kinetics of oxidation, one must replicate the environment in which the material will operate.

Replicating High-Temperature Environments

The furnace is designed to maintain high temperatures, specifically targeting the 800°C and 900°C range.

This capability allows researchers to observe how the NiCoCrAlY material behaves under the thermal loads it would experience in actual industrial applications.

Long-Term Static Testing

The reference specifies that these furnaces are used for long-term static tests.

Unlike short bursts of heat, these extended durations expose the cumulative effects of oxidation, revealing how the material degrades over time rather than just its immediate reaction to heat.

Verifying Protective Mechanisms

The ultimate goal of using these furnaces is to validate the effectiveness of the material's protective strategies.

Testing Oxygen Diffusion Inhibition

The furnace environment tests the integrity of the pre-oxidized α-Al2O3 layer.

By maintaining a constant temperature, researchers can isolate variables and determine if this layer successfully acts as a barrier to prevent oxygen from penetrating the coating.

Monitoring TGO Growth Rates

A critical metric in these studies is the growth rate of Thermally Grown Oxides (TGO).

The stable thermal field provided by the furnace ensures that any observed slowing of TGO growth is due to the material's properties, not fluctuations in the test environment.

Understanding the Trade-offs

While essential for kinetic studies, it is important to recognize the specific scope of these tests.

Static vs. Cyclic Limitations

The primary reference explicitly notes these are static isothermal tests.

This means the furnace maintains a constant temperature, which is excellent for studying chemical oxidation kinetics but does not simulate the mechanical stresses caused by rapid heating and cooling cycles (thermal cycling) often found in engine operations.

Dependence on Thermal Stability

The reliability of the data is entirely dependent on the furnace's ability to maintain a stable thermal field.

If the furnace lacks industrial-grade precision, minor temperature fluctuations can skew the data regarding oxygen diffusion rates, leading to incorrect conclusions about the coating's lifespan.
